Médecins Sans Frontières (MSF) is an international, independent, medical humanitarian organization that delivers emergency aid to people affected by armed conflict, epidemics, natural disasters, and exclusion from healthcare. Médecins Sans Frontières provides assistance to populations in distress, to victims of natural or man-made disasters and to victims of armed conflict. They do so irrespective of race, religion, creed, or political convictions. www.msf.org

Job Title: Health Promoter Community Engagament Supervisor
Location: Anambra
Contract Period: Definite
Main Duties and Responsibilities
With the support and guidance of the Health Promoter & Community Engagement (HPCE) Manager, responsible for implementing the HPCE strategy / workplan, with community participation, and supervising the HPCE activities and HP teams working in the communities or the health facilities, according to the project objectives, MSF values, standards and procedures.
HPCE strategy, activities and monitoring:
Actively contribute to the design/adaptation of the HPCE strategy / workplan.
Lead and follow up on the implementation of the HPCE strategy / workplan, according to the chronogram.
Support participatory approaches and regular patient/community consultations before and during implementation of the HPCE strategy.
Organizing health awareness sessions for MSF's medical and non-medical staff
Support in the design of health education materials and participatory methods, applying the right process (pretesting, validation of content, translation).
Contribute to rapid assessments and surveys.
Actively support in the systematic collection, encoding and reporting of community feedback and rumours.
If relevant, support the implementation of community-based surveillance (data collection, active case finding, tracing, linkage to care.
Responsible for the planning and organization of community meetings (in collaboration with HPCE Manager).
Contribute to the community mapping.
Monitoring:
Ensure the availability of the data collection tools; the data encoding in the data base and the quality check.
Contribute to the analysis of the monitoring data and look for adjustments (in collaboration with HPCE manager), monthly reporting (MMR, sitrep,…).
Team management:
Contribute to evaluation of the Health Promotion (HP) team, with the Health Promoter & Community Engagement (HPCE) manager.
Contribute to the development plan for the HP team.
Training: Contribute to the needs assessment, design and implementation of training for the HP team, in collaboration with the HPCE manager.
Organize regular and systematic supervision of the HP activities and provide on the job-coaching.
Ensure the planning and practical organisation of the activities for the HP team (HP roaster).
Ensure the organisation of regular HP team meetings.
MSF Section/Context Specific Accountabilities
Raise awareness about MSF’s principles and services in the community and among MSF staff
Contribute to the Health Seeking Behaviour Assessment by gathering community insights, barriers and facilitators to accessing care.
Establish channels (e.g. suggestions boxes, community meetings, hotline, etc) for communities to voice concerns and suggestions about MSF services
Together with the HP team, ensure HPCE materials are tailored to literacy levels and cultural norms
In collaboration with relevant stakeholders, contribute to the design of the survivor referral pathway and ensure clear, accessible information is shared with communities and staff
Contribute to training/capacity building of community focal points on violence awareness raisons with a specific focus on gender-based violence, sexual violence and survivor-centred approach, including principles of confidentiality, respect, non-discrimination, and informed consent.
Safeguard confidentiality to ensure all survivor-related information is handled with strict confidentiality and follow protocols for safe documentation, storage, and communication of sensitive information
